The Risks of "Cracked" Community Tools: A Look at Peacock-v7.5.0-crack.7z
If you’ve been looking for ways to play HITMAN offline or on local servers, you’ve likely come across the Peacock Project. It’s a fantastic community-driven tool that provides a custom server replacement. However, a file named Peacock-v7.5.0-crack.7z has been circulating in certain corners of the internet, and it’s a major red flag.
Here is why you should avoid this file at all costs and what you need to know about the real Peacock Project. 1. Peacock is Already Free and Open Source
The biggest giveaway that Peacock-v7.5.0-crack.7z is dangerous is that the real Peacock Project is free. There is nothing to "crack." The developers host the project openly on GitHub and their official website.
Any file claiming to be a "crack" for a free, open-source tool is almost certainly a delivery vehicle for malware, such as:
Infostealers: Designed to grab your saved passwords, browser cookies, and crypto wallet keys. Ransomware: Locking your files until you pay a fee.
Botnets: Using your computer’s resources to perform DDoS attacks or mine cryptocurrency. 2. Version Number Discrepancies
Malicious actors often use inflated version numbers to make their "updates" seem more advanced or official than the current stable release. Before downloading, always cross-reference the version number with the official Peacock GitHub repository or their official Discord server. If the "crack" version is higher than the official release, it’s a fake. 3. The Danger of .7z and .Zip Executables
While .7z is a legitimate compression format, it is frequently used by attackers to bypass basic antivirus scanners. Once you extract the archive, you will likely find an .exe or .bat file. Running these gives the code full permission to alter your system settings, disable your antivirus, and install persistent backdoors. How to Stay Safe If you want to use Peacock for HITMAN, follow these rules: Only download from the source: Use thepeacockproject.com.
Check the Wiki: The official project has extensive documentation. If a site asks you to "disable antivirus to run the crack," close the tab immediately.
Scan suspicious files: If you’ve already downloaded a weird file, upload it to VirusTotal before opening it. It will check the file against dozens of different antivirus engines.
There is no such thing as a "Peacock Crack" because there is nothing to pay for. Peacock-v7.5.0-crack.7z is a scam. Stay safe, support the actual developers, and stick to the official channels.

The Peacock Project is a server replacement for Hitman (2016), Hitman 2, and Hitman 3. It allows players to experience the game’s "online" features—such as progression, unlocks, and rating systems—on their own local machines without connecting to official servers. It is primarily used for:
Game Preservation: Ensuring the game remains playable if official servers ever shut down.
Custom Content: Accessing features or elusive targets that are normally time-limited.
Offline Progression: Allowing "online" functionality for players with unstable internet or those using pirated versions of the game. Security Warning for "Crack" Files
Files named with "crack" and archived as .7z (like Peacock-v7.5.0-crack.7z) found on third-party sites are often high-risk.
Malware Risk: The Peacock Project itself is open-source and free; it does not require a "crack." Files labeled this way often contain bundled malware, miners, or credential stealers.
Official Sources: The legitimate software is hosted on The Peacock Project GitHub or their official website . Always verify the version number (e.g., v7.5.0) against the official release logs. Usage in the Community
In enthusiast communities, such as r/PiratedGames , Peacock is frequently discussed as a tool to bridge the gap between "cracked" game files and the official "online-only" progression systems.
